    OK, I should qualify my opinion rather than just bagging it ..... sorry.

    At the very least the liner / strap seems too clean and the marks in the photos are odd ( chemical ageing?? ) Maybe it has been out? and for me it does not look as grubby as the outside is worn. That is red flag #1 for me.
    Then there seems ( from my view of the photos at least ) a paint "wash" effect that would have worn away if done 70 years ago - seems to be more noticeable on the green.
    Then the tease of a corner of the decal to me is telling of someone who doesn't want to give away that it is a copy but still 'sex' up the helmet.

    I would truly love to be wrong for your sake but after seeing so many good faux paint jobs I've become cold & cynical of all cammos - ESPECIALLY SS!

    Regards, Dan

    edit - the construction of the decal is wrong I think? More expert than I will give you a better answer.
